Combinational equivalence checking method based on universal cut and special cut

Jun YANG,Fei-jun ZHENG,Yong-jiang LU,Hai-tong GE,Xiao-lang YAN
DOI: https://doi.org/10.3785/j.issn.1008-973X.2006.09.009
2006-01-01
Abstract:To increase the speed of equivalence checking for combinational circuits, a method using internal equivalence information of circuits in verification was proposed. Universal cut and special cut were combined in the method. Universal cut was generated by tracing from primary outputs, and equivalence of all candidate equivalent points (CEPs) was verified by using universal cut. After special cut was generated by tracing from a special pair of CEP, dependencies among high level nodes in special cut were removed for optimization, and the equivalence for the special pair of CEP was verified by using special cut. Experimental results show that compared with traditional dependency removal strategy, the dependency removal strategy in the method can reduce the time of verification. Compared with the method only using universal cut or special cut, the method can obviously improve the speed of verification for combinational circuits.
What problem does this paper attempt to address?